Background technology
Tobacco black shank is most important disease in tobacco leaf production, and incidence is high, has a very wide distribution, caused by it is economical
It loses huge.China is in addition to Heilongjiang Province not yet finds the disease, and there are generation in other each plant cigarette provinces, for many years, to the disease
Prevention mainly use based on chemical prevention, and in conjunction with the method for integrated control supplemented by cultivation step.Due to being used for a long time
The resistance of chemical agent, many disease-resistant varieties is lost, and cause of disease but produces drug resistance.In recent years, due to soil sheet company side,
Cause tobacco planting crop rotation difficult, balck shank aggravates year by year, is badly in need of that the improved seeds of balck shank, selection and breeding to be resisted to resist black shin in production
The kind of disease is the basic method for solving the disease.
Therefore it is badly in need of a kind of quickening breeding process, improves efficiency of selection, shortens the breeding technique of the breeding time limit.Traditional is roasting
Cigarette new variety selective breeding technology mainly use " pedigree method ", strain stablize after carry out again disease resistance and quality etc. it is related identify;
Breeding Process is longer, less efficient.

The present invention is realized by following technical proposals:
A kind of anti-balck shank kind directed cultivation method of flue-cured tobacco:
Mainly selection and breeding flow is:Screening → parental apolegamy of germ plasm resource → F1 Disease garden identifications → F2-3 for sick nursery screen →
The crop fields F4-6 identification → ore grade indexes → variety test of lines → regional testing → pilot production → variety certification;
Wherein:Include the following steps:
1, the apolegamy and hybridization of excellent complementary parent material:
Excellent complementary parent material is filtered out from anti-balck shank, high yield, good Germplasms and is hybridized;
2, the high new lines of balck shank strong drought resistance, yield are selected in directive breeding;
A, the selection and breeding of first-filial generation:
All F1 generations are directly planted in balck shank sick nursery, and screening growing way is good in sick nursery, and the high generation of yield only selects group
It closes, not menu strain directly selects the combination of anti-balck shank;
A1:The generation having outstanding performance is directly entered quality identification, the examination of strain area and production demonstration;
A2:Disease-resistant generation material enters F2 generation selections;
B, F2-3 is screened for sick nursery:
F2-3 directly plants in balck shank garden for material, screens that anti-balck shank ability is strong, yield is high in segregating population
New lines, F2-3 are planted and are screened under the conditions of sick nursery connects bacterium for material, so that its anti-balck shank characteristic is given full expression to, and to shape
State feature, yielding ability and other Disease Resistances carry out natural selection, retain a variety of variation types as possible;
C, the crop fields F4-6 are identified:
F4-F6 is planted for material under normal test conditions, selects strain best in quality;Normal condition plant when pair
Morphological feature, resistance and the yield potentiality of material are selected;Emphasis is to correlation merit character simultaneously, such as chemical composition, perfume (or spice)
Gas ingredient, sensory evaluating smoking etc. screen;
D, ore grade indexes:
Stable advanced clones carry out variety test of lines, mainly comprehensively relatively comment the stabilization strain progress selected
Valence is carried out at the same time the identification of other diseases;
E, regional testing:
To showing preferable material, emphasis proves the adaptability and yielding ability of strain, and certain property with check variety
The difference of shape, yielding ability, resistance and the adaptability of the regional testing major diagnostic kind, and identify kind under different year
Yield stability under different cultivation techniques and ecological condition and adaptability are selected more comprehensive than control kind yield, the output value and quality etc.
The suitable or excellent quality product kind of character;
F, pilot production:
Including experiment in cultivation, baked test, mutilocation trial, industrial evaluation etc.;The characteristics of for kind and production item
Part carries out the research of cultivation technique, is integrated to kind and cultivation technique, in different lifes close to Production of Large Fields
Yielding ability, resistance and the adaptability of state area identification of species provide scientific basis to promote and apply;
G, variety certification:
Determine kind planting area.
The present invention has the following advantages compared with traditional selection method:
The present invention is characterized in that:In F1-F3 generations, directly plant in balck shank sick nursery, early generation to the resistance of balck shank into
Identification is gone.The F1 generation combination having outstanding performance, can be directly entered ore grade indexes, substantially reduce the selection and breeding time;Performance is preferable
In combination, i.e. F2-3 generations, continue to plant in balck shank garden, selection target single plant or type from segregating population so that selected type was both
With high yielding character, and the characteristic with anti-balck shank.
It can accelerate breeding process, shorten the breeding time limit, the present invention has carried out the screening of balck shank in early generation, reduces later stage disease
The time of evil identification.
Breeding work amount can be reduced, breeding efficiency is improved.
The present invention has carried out the identification of balck shank in early generation, it is ensured that the resistance of selected excellent strain balck shank, to not anti-black
The group of shin disease eliminates in early generation, greatly reduces the workload of seed selection;With conventional variety selection and breeding mostly for carrying out black shin after material
The identification method of disease is compared, and is substantially increased anti-balck shank breeding efficiency, is shortened breeding process.
Sick nursery breeding can quickly bring out regularity height, the reliable disease-resistant variety of stability compared with conventional breeding methods.

Embodiment 1
Cigarette No. 7 kinds in Henan are flue-cured tobacco first-filial generation kind.
Preparing hybrid combination in 2002,2003--2004 carry out ore grade indexes experiment in balck shank sick nursery, join within 2005
Henan Province's flue-cured tobacco breeding regional testing is added, 2006-2007 participates in national flue-cured tobacco breeding regional testing, while having participated in 2006
Henan Province's new flue-cured tobacco varieties matching technique study in year and 2007 and other small areas produced demonstration test, and in 2007 8
The moon is commented by saving, and is named as Henan cigarette 7.2008-2009 has carried out main matching technique study and Perfect the work, 2009 years into
The area's trial production of the row whole nation is tested and is evaluated by national broadacre agriculture, is examined by national flue-cured tobacco cultivars validation board within 2010
It is fixed.
The kind has following outstanding feature:
(1), yield of tobacco, the output value are above control NC89, have relatively stable agricultural performance and higher agricultural
Utility value.
(2), tobacco aroma quality is preferable, and perfume quantity foot, sensory evaluating smoking is high-quality, and main chemical compositions are coordinated, especially potassium
Content is high, and vane thickness is uniform, has preferable industrial utility value.
(3), No. 7 anti-balck shanks of Henan cigarette, moderate resistance rust and bacterial wilt, resistance to PVY, middle sense root knot nematode disease and TMV, sense
CMV.Comprehensive disease resistance is better than control NC89.
(4), especially suitable suitable for the plantation of Henan Province's province's all regions and part the Yellow River and Huai He River cigarette district with wider adaptability
It closes and is planted in balck shank and the higher continuous cropping vega of rust incidence and area.
Embodiment 2
The Y106 strains are conventional hybridization kind.
2002, be female parent with middle cigarette 101, and 664-01 is that paternal hybrid obtains F1, 2003 in balck shank sick nursery kind
It plants, selfing obtains F2, planted in balck shank sick nursery within 2004~2005 years, 2006-2007 in field planting, using pedigree method into
Row Single-plant selection obtains stable strain.Carry out ore grade indexes and small area demonstration test within 2008;Participate in river within 2009~2011 years
South saves flue-cured tobacco cultivars regional testing;Participate in the whole nation within 2012~2013 years(Northern area)Flue-cured tobacco cultivars regional testing, while participating in river
South saves new flue-cured tobacco varieties and compares demonstration test, and carries out related matching technique study;Participate in the whole nation within 2014(Northern area)Flue-cured tobacco
Variety production is tested.In August, 2014 is evaluated by national broadacre agriculture.
The strain has following outstanding feature:
(1) drought-enduring, yield stability is good, and Economic returns are high;
(2) disease resistance is good, anti-balck shank, moderate resistance rust;
(3) easily baking is planted suitable for north cigarette district.
